What is LiteBot?
LiteBot is a Codex pet, a small animated character you install into the Codex CLI. Once hatched it appears in your terminal as a companion while you code.
How do I install LiteBot?
Run `curl -fsSL "https://www.aimcp.info/api/codex-pets/litebot-f2dba79c/package.zip" -o "$HOME/.codex/pets/lite-bot.zip" && mkdir -p "$HOME/.codex/pets/lite-bot" && unzip -o "$HOME/.codex/pets/lite-bot.zip" -d "$HOME/.codex/pets/lite-bot" && rm "$HOME/.codex/pets/lite-bot.zip"` in your terminal to download the package into `~/.codex/pets/`, then open `/pet` inside Codex and select LiteBot to activate it.
